Fans have expectations from Rohit-Kohli in Sydney, confident of India's victory

Sydney, October 25 (IANS). Australia won the toss and decided to bat in the ongoing third ODI at the Sydney Cricket Ground. Even though Team India lost the series by losing the first two matches of the series, Indian fans came to support the team in Sydney. Fans have high expectations from Rohit Sharma and Virat Kohli in this match. A fan present outside the stadium told IANS, “All the fans feel that this could be Virat Kohli’s last match in Sydney.
